What "ask a vet free online" really offers

Not all online veterinarian aid is produced equal. Some services are staffed by qualified veterinarians providing general advice. Others depend on veterinary nurses or seasoned moderators. A few are simple Q and A forums where responses come from a mix of specialists and experienced owners. The best of the totally free choices supply triage, education, and sensible steps, yet they do not detect, suggest, or change hands‑on exams.

There are lawful limits. In the majority of areas, a vet requires a legitimate veterinary‑client‑patient relationship to detect and prescribe. Without an established relationship, they can just give general recommendations. That matters for assumptions. You may obtain suggestions like, "This pattern of throwing up in a young pet that is still brilliant and moisturized can commonly be monitored for 12 to 24 hours," or, "Those images look like surface paw abrasions, clean carefully and look for swelling." You need to not anticipate, "This is pancreatitis, start this medication."

Where complimentary help beams: triage and preparation. A five‑minute conversation can arrange symptoms right into careful waiting versus same‑day care, educate you what holistapet to check, and help you walk into a paid go to with the appropriate history and photos. That prep improves care and trims prices since you will prevent duplicate tests, ask much better inquiries, and occasionally miss an unneeded emergency fee.

The price tags behind typical decisions

Knowing what you are attempting to prevent helps. A common primary care exam charge runs 50 to 120 bucks, relying on place. After‑hours emergency situation exams commonly begin at 150 to 300 prior to any screening or therapy. Include bloodwork, and you may see 120 to 250. A solitary X‑ray sight can be 100 to 200, with a lot of research studies requiring 2 or 3 views. Ear cytology is 30 to 60. A parvovirus test averages 40 to 70. None of these are naturally "poor," they are devices, however the costs climbs up fast when you walk right into the incorrect setup or order tests that do not alter the plan.

The cost savings from a well‑timed complimentary speak with are not abstract. If you can safely maintain a stable, slightly scratchy pet out of the ER on Saturday night and publication a Monday consultation, you might reduce your bill by a 3rd or much more. If you can keep an eye on one episode of throwing up with a plan and prevent the waterfall of IV liquids and imaging that several Emergency rooms default to, you conserve hundreds.

When cost-free online advice is enough

There are patterns that, in healthy family pets, frequently reply to time, home care, and straightforward tracking. If you can keep your pet comfortable and moisturized, and if actions stays normal, a short home window of careful waiting is sensible. Utilize the following as a practical lens when you ask a veterinarian complimentary online. You can likewise paste this checklist right into a conversation to assist the specialist orient quickly.

  • Minor problems in a bright, stable animal: one episode of vomiting or soft stool without blood, no high temperature, typical cravings and power after the episode, and normal hydration.
  • Mild skin or ear irritability: light damaging, no head tilt, no swelling or malodor, and your animal tolerates gentle cleaning.
  • Intermittent coughing or sneezing without taking a breath effort: consuming and playing usually, periodontals pink, no open‑mouth breathing, and episodes short and infrequent.
  • Small shallow wounds: superficial abrasions or nicks that stop bleeding rapidly, are not over joints or eyes, and do not gape wider than a grain of rice.
  • Behavior or nutrition concerns: stool high quality on a brand-new diet, picky eating in an animal otherwise flourishing, secure enrichment concepts, or fundamental precautionary care timing.

This is where a cost-free chat helps you choose what to do in the house, for how long to watch, what essential indicators to track, and what would certainly make you rise. It likewise aids you establish a clever facility check out if required. For instance, a veterinarian might suggest you bring a fresh feces sample to a Monday appointment so you do not spend for a second trip.

Red flags that demand in‑person care now

Some signs are time delicate since they indicate discomfort, body organ stress and anxiety, or a risk of quick decline. Free recommendations can still lead you in these instances, yet the appropriate suggestions will be to go in, and earlier is almost always less costly and safer.

  • Troubled breathing: fast or struggled respiration at rest, open‑mouth breathing in a cat, blue or pale gum tissues, or a breathing price consistently over 40 breaths per minute at rest in either species.
  • Repeated throwing up with sleepiness: more than two or 3 episodes in a couple of hours, inability to maintain water down, bloated abdominal areas, or any kind of vomiting in a really young pup or kitten.
  • Straining to pee or lack of ability to pass pee: specifically in male pet cats, who can block and weaken over a few hours.
  • Sudden collapse, seizures, or serious ruthless pain: sobbing out, declining to move, a swollen unpleasant abdominal area, or pale gums.
  • Toxins or trauma: recognized direct exposure to delicious chocolate, xylitol, grapes or raisins, rodenticide, lilies in pet cats, human discomfort medications, or any hit by vehicle, attack wounds, or drops from height.

If you discover on your own negotiating with any of these, do not. The price of waiting climbs up quick once shock, dehydration, or body organ injury starts. Even a phone call with a free solution will push you to embrace these.

Making the most of a free online consult

The top quality of help you get depends on the quality of information you offer. Prior to you open a chat window, collect a few key points that vets use to triage. You do not need expensive gear, just a watch, a phone cam, and your observations.

Start with a clear timeline. What occurred first, how much time has it been taking place, and what has changed? If your pet vomited at 7 p.m. After a brand-new reward, after that ate supper and played bring, that is different from a pet that has actually declined water given that twelve noon and vomited twice since.

Capture brief video clips and images. A 15‑second clip of the coughing noise, the limp at a stroll, or the way your cat breathes at rest saves 10 minutes of thinking. Pictures of the stool, the wound, or the rash under excellent light go a long way. Utilize a coin or a ruler in the structure for size.

Note vitals and hydration. Matter relaxing breaths by enjoying the breast fluctuate for 30 secs and increase by 2. Healthy dogs rest around 10 to 35 breaths per minute, pet cats 16 to 40. Inspect gum tissue color under normal light, trying to find pink and moist. Lift the skin over the shoulder blades and see just how quick it breaks back. If you have a thermostat, a regular rectal temperature level is approximately 100.0 to 102.5 F. If you do not have one, do not improvise, avoid temperature level and share the rest.

List whatever your pet ate and any type of medications or supplements, including flea, tick, or heartworm preventives. Some adverse results resemble illness. A vet on the various other end will certainly also wish to know age, type, spay or neuter standing, and known conditions. For pet cats, interior versus outdoor issues. For pet dogs, recent rough play, off‑leash adventures, or access to garbage usually solves the mystery.

Finally, describe behavior. Is your family pet bright and interactive, oversleeping the usual areas, eating with rate of interest, and replying to you? Or withdrawn, hiding, refusing favorite deals with, or looking for isolation? Refined changes in behavior can outweigh a solitary symptom.

Three usual scenarios and just how on-line triage saves money

A young adult canine throws up as soon as after a long walk, then asks for food. In this instance, a cost-free conversation can assist you skip the ER. You will likely be informed to relax the intestine, provide percentages of water, monitor for more vomiting, and look for sleepiness, distention, or duplicated retching. You might be suggested to attempt an easy dull meal the following early morning if no additional throwing up appears. If things aggravate or warnings show up, you pivot to care. You prevented a 200 buck late‑night exam by gathering the appropriate information and viewing with intention.

A feline begins scraping at one ear, trembling the head a couple of times in the evening. A video clip reveals occasional drinks, the ear canal looks pink however not raw, and there is a brown wax. A vet online can walk you with gentle cleaning with a pet‑safe ear rinse and a plan to schedule a same‑week consultation for an examination and a cytology, which is cost-effective and beneficial. You missed the ER surcharge and still aligned the correct test that guides therapy, instead of jumping to a steroid that could mask infection.

A medium‑breed pet dog surfaces a backyard zoomie session and turns up a little bit unsatisfactory on a back leg. The canine can toe touch, will certainly relax easily, and consumes supper. A complimentary consult can educate you rest, ice or great compresses, and what aggravating appear like, while discouraging the very human impulse to offer advil or acetaminophen, which can hurt pet dogs and is dangerous for pet cats. You intend a weekday visit if the limp does not enhance in two days. You stayed clear of a battery of weekend X‑rays that hardly ever transform preliminary management in a steady dog.

The fragile line with home treatment: what is risk-free, what is not

Plenty of home actions are risk-free. Gentle wound cleansing with saline or diluted chlorhexidine, a temporary soft diet like boiled chicken and rice for light intestinal trouble in pet dogs, or fundamental hydration strategies for a pet cat that is a little picky on hot days are common.

There are likewise tough lines. Do not give human discomfort medications unless a veterinarian who understands your pet has informed you specifically what and how much. Acetaminophen is exceptionally hazardous to pet cats. Ibuprofen and naproxen can cause ulcers and kidney damage in pet dogs. Stay clear of utilizing remaining antibiotics without guidance, which can mask signs and symptoms and promote resistance. Be cautious with over‑the‑counter anti‑diarrheals. Some solutions consist of xylitol or bismuth compounds that make complex care. When in doubt, ask first.

If a complimentary chat offers you a thumbs-up for a home step, confirm the concentration of any kind of service, the amount to utilize, and how usually. A lot more is not better with antiseptics. Rubbing raw skin delays healing. A determined, gentle technique keeps you from transforming a tiny problem into a larger one.

Choosing the appropriate setup saves the most money

If you determine to seek in‑person care, the setup matters as high as the timing. A same‑day appointment at a basic technique is generally less costly than the emergency room for noncritical issues. Numerous practices hold a couple of daily slots for urgent but secure cases. Calling when the phones open and explaining your pet dog's stability, with your video and vitals in hand, usually obtains you one of those spots.

For vaccinations and routine screening, community clinics or shelter‑affiliated occasions can cut expenses by fifty percent or more. Spay and neuter, dental cleanings, and some orthopedic treatments benefit from a hospital setting with complete tracking, however even then you can request an estimate, line by line, and whether any items are optional or can be presented. Excellent methods welcome that conversation.

Do not ignore qualified vet nurses. Many facilities supply registered nurse consultations for nail trims, stitch removals, plaster checks, rectal gland expression, and weight or high blood pressure checks at a reduced fee. If a vet requires to step in, they will, but the registered nurse see keeps little things small.

Medications and tests: just how to prevent paying twice

If a veterinarian recommends a prescription, request for a written manuscript. Numerous drugs are available at human drug stores, frequently at lower money costs. Amoxicillin‑clavulanate, doxycycline, and some pain medicines for canines are common instances. Price‑check with a price cut program or app, and call a few pharmacies before you devote. Worsened drugs can assist with tiny doses for pet cats or flavorful liquids, though they may cost even more. If you need to make use of a vet pharmacy for a certain item, ask if generic matchings exist.

With diagnostics, ask what the examination will certainly change. Ear cytology guides the best decreases. A fecal test identifies bloodsuckers so you can treat exactly rather than thinking. In contrast, a complete chemistry panel on a young, bright canine with a small concern might not change your strategy that day. When a veterinarian explains that an examination is a screen to eliminate unsafe yet less likely problems, you get to make a decision whether that satisfaction is worth the cost right now.

Bring evidence. If you have a video clip of the cough, the vet might not need to induce one during the exam. If you charted relaxing respiratory system rates for a couple of days, you might be able to skip a breast X‑ray in a secure animal. If you taped just how typically and how much your feline beverages, a facility can run targeted laboratories as opposed to buying every panel under the sun.

Preventive care that pays for itself

The most inexpensive emergency is the one you never have. Routine dental cleanings avoid abscesses and removals that set you back two to four times extra. Bloodsucker prevention quits heartworm condition that can set you back 1,000 to 1,800 bucks to treat in pets and is normally fatal in pet cats. Weight control avoids cruciate ligament tears and diabetes, both expensive in money and time. A diet that suits your pet dog's age and health, measured dishes, and everyday play matter more than pattern supplements.

Insurance and savings plans deserve a sober appearance. Accident‑only plans are affordable and cover the large crashes: broken bones, foreign bodies, lacerations. Comprehensive plans set you back even more yet support persistent health problems like allergies and joint inflammation. If you can not stomach monthly costs, a committed savings account with an automated transfer constructs an individual safeguard. Free on-line veterinarian services typically help you decide which tier you need based on your family pet's danger profile.

Using on the internet guidance to prepare for a paid visit

One of the underappreciated ways to conserve cash is preparing for a check out so it runs efficiently. After a totally free chat confirms you require an appointment, ask what to bring. A pee sample gathered first thing in the early morning can spare your pet tension and you a charge for a collection procedure. A listing of foods and treats with pictures of component panels helps in allergic reaction workups. If the recommendations recommends a likely ear infection, ask whether to miss cleansing before the visit so the vet can see material for cytology.

Arrive with your videos cued, the sign timeline on your phone, and details inquiries. You might ask, "If the X‑ray is regular, would we still deal with the limp with rest and anti‑inflammatories?" or, "If the bloodwork is typical, do we still alter the diet plan?" These decision points keep you from buying tests that will not alter your actions.

Edge cases and judgment calls

Not every situation fits neat policies. A single episode of vomiting in a diabetic dog is not regular. A "mild" limp in an elderly greyhound can disclose bone cancer. A calm pet cat that unexpectedly conceals under the bed may be in discomfort. Breed and age alter the mathematics. Brachycephalic pet dogs that snore under the most effective of scenarios will certainly be less forgiving of a coughing. Kitties and toy type pups can dry out frighteningly fast. Make use of totally free consultations to consider those subtleties, but do not allow them change the fact in front of you. If your intestine states your pet dog is not right, and the indicators line up with red flags, go.

On the other hand, you will certainly sometimes rest with unclear signs. A four‑year‑old canine has a soft feces after daycare, then goes back to typical. You could most likely to the ER and spend 300 dollars to hear "watch overnight," or you can see over night with a strategy in your pocket from an on the internet vet. The art remains in recognizing when the threat of waiting is small.

A couple of numbers worth memorizing

Resting respiration for pet dogs normally drops in between 10 and 35 breaths per min. For cats, think 16 to 40. A comfy relaxing price listed below about 30 is typically reassuring. Typical periodontal shade is bubblegum pink, wet, and capillary refill under two seconds when you push gently and release. A typical rectal temperature relaxes 100.0 to 102.5 F. If you can not gauge these, do not panic, simply define what you see. An expert can teach you to count breaths from a video or inform you when numbers are essential.

Know common toxin wrongdoers: chocolate, grapes and raisins, xylitol sugar, rodenticides, certain important oils in cats, all human pain medicines unless clearly recommended by a veterinarian, and lilies in cats. If exposure is possible, skip the totally free conversation step and call a poison control hotline or head to care. Time issues for purification, and early activity is cheaper than late treatment.

The quiet worth of documentation

Keep a straightforward log for your pet. Weights at home or from current gos to, inoculation days, preventative doses, and any type of prior ailments or surgical treatments create a baseline. When something fails, you will certainly not be guessing. Free on-line guidance ends up being sharper when the person helping you can see that your pet cat's regular weight is 11.4 pounds and the last 2 months showed a sluggish drift to 10.8, or that your canine's resting breathing price last week was continually 18 to 20.

Store videos and pictures in a pet album on your phone. Label them with days. If a cough audio adjustments or a rash spreads, you have proof. That proof trims time in the exam room, sustains or shoots down a diagnosis, and often prevents a test.
